About the facility Atria Encino Terrace

Enjoy a bustling, urban life with assisted or independent living at Atria Encino Terrace in Encino, California. Nestled on the lively Ventura Boulevard, this multi-story community resembles a quaint Italian villa complete with a charming, rustic color scheme and delicate awnings atop the oversized windows. As part of the Los Angeles Metropolitan Area, Encino will offer you the opportunity to have lots of big-city amenities at your fingertips.

From this walkable location, you can access nearby stores and restaurants for easy entertainment and shopping. Feel at ease knowing the Encino Hospital Medical Center campus offers medical resources down the street from this community. Eligible veterans may seek healthcare through the Sepulveda Veterans Affairs Medical Center, just a short distance away. Take advantage of the California weather by hitting the links with your buddies at Balboa Golf Course. Embrace the splendor of nature at the expansive Sepulveda Wildlife Area. Grab your friends for a picnic and a stroll through the picturesque Los Encinos State Historic Park. Watch a breathtaking sunset at the nearby Encino Reservoir, tucked into the scenic Santa Monica Mountains. Spend your time at Atria Encino Terracedoing what you love the most!

Our Experience

I've worked in hospitality all my life and have never experienced such poor treatment and service to ANY group of people. They have since terminated the head nurse and the ED, which helps. Many of the staff treated my loved one very rudely. She has Parkinson's and was always being rushed and was told that she was taking too long. She became very depressed by the treatment. She hated the food. There were roaches. Maintenance was working alone for the entire building, so he never had time to help with repairs etc. The accountant would never provide accurate ledgers or any ledger and we were constantly under threat of eviction due to their messy bookkeeping. At times, there would literally be no caregivers or one for the entire building. It was horrible.

Atria Encino Terrace is a Total Positive

Atria Encino Terrace has been a great fit for my mother since her arrival in Aug 2023. What I seek most as primary hallmarks after 13 years of parent care in various assisted living residences are the kindness of staff and the cleanliness of the residence. After that, the responsiveness of management, then the delivery of medical /wellness services, meals, and activities. Many residences advertise this, but Atria Encino Terrace actually delivers a feeling of family because many of the care staff and management have worked together in the community for years. Turnover in staff at other residences creates confusion and impersonality for the residents and their families. Her meds are given regularly which I can see from the improvement of her chronic conditions. Meals are recognizable, homey foods that people eat. The Engagement director and staff not only schedule a variety of activities day and evening, but sweetly interact with residents throughout.

Frequently Asked Questions about Atria Encino Terrace

Atria Encino Terrace offers Studio and 1 Bedroom. Learn more.

A Place for Mom has scored Atria Encino Terrace 9.4 out of 10 using our proprietary review score.

We assign review scores to give a more reliable view into senior living communities and home care agencies. Our review scores prioritize reviews that are recent — the past 24 months — because we know families need current information when choosing senior care.

Those with many recent, positive reviews receive a high review score, while providers with few recent reviews — regardless of how positive — receive a lower review score. Communities with no recent reviews will not have a review score, even if older reviews are positive. The maximum A Place for Mom review score a community can receive is 10 points.
